How do you save for Web in Photoshop?

Using the Save For Web dialog box

Open a photo, and choose File > Save For Web. Then choose a format from the file format menu (GIF, JPEG, PNG‑8, or PNG‑24) and set options as desired. (The file format menu is directly beneath the Preset menu.) This saves a copy of your file, without overwriting the original image.

What happened to Save for Web in Photoshop?

Tim’s Quick Answer: In effect, the “Save for Web” command previously found on the File menu in Photoshop has simply be renamed to “Export”. There is an option for “Quick Export as PNG”, or you can choose “Export As” to configure the settings similar to what you had previously done with the “Save for Web” feature.

Can not Save for Web in Photoshop?

The Save for web error may be a sign of damaged preferences, so press and hold Alt+Control+Shift keyboard shortcut as you start Photoshop. You’ll be immediately prompted to delete the current settings. Finally, new preferences files will be created the next time you start Photoshop.

Why is Save for Web grayed out in Photoshop?

Check your document’s bit depth. If you have a 32-bit document, Save For Web will be disabled.

How do I save a PNG in Photoshop 2020?

Save in PNG format

  1. Choose File > Save As, and choose PNG from the Format menu.
  2. Select an Interlace option: None. Displays the image in a browser only when download is complete. Interlaced. Displays low-resolution versions of the image in a browser as the file downloads. …
  3. Click OK.

How do I use Save for Web legacy?

You can use Export As to create a copy of a Photoshop document in the PNG, JPEG, GIF, or SVG format. Export As is the newer way to save web graphics from Photoshop. Long-time Photoshop users may be more familiar with the dialog box now called Save for Web (Legacy) (choose File > Export > Save for Web (Legacy)).
